The Mooncake Festival, also known as Mid-Autumn Festival, falls
on the 15th day of the eighth lunar month. It's celebrates the
time when the moon is furthest from the earth and is said to be
perfectly round. The moon symbolizes balance, harmony and family.
This is a very happy festival as families & neighbours gather
together for moon-watching parties whilst children carry brightly-coloured
lanterns. Mooncakes filled with exotic fare & tea is always
served.
